Output 753987f80cf15e56e9468a96048f50780967c19e726a0ae6c19a775d25c6bad0:0

value
141676368
script pubkey
OP_0 OP_PUSHBYTES_20 ff123a871a9a0288ae5d05d6e1053351afae59d5
address
bc1qlufr4pc6ngpg3tjaqhtwzpfn2xh6ukw4pvwfwd
transaction
753987f80cf15e56e9468a96048f50780967c19e726a0ae6c19a775d25c6bad0
spent
true